The Structural Engineer, Volume 60, Issue 14, 1982
Ten simply supported 1.5 m square, under-reinforced, orthogonally prestressed concrete slabs have been tested to failure under centrally applied concentrated loading. Nominal concrete strength was 50 N/mm2. Steel ratio, platen size and average prestress were varied. Concrete strains, steel strains and slab deflections were measured during each test. H.0. Okafor and S.H. Perry
